Çayırhan power station
Power station
Çayırhan power station is a 620 MW operational coal fired power station in Turkey in Ankara Province. In 2019 land was expropriated for another lignite mine, to feed the a proposed extension, which was opposed as uneconomic and eventually had its licence revoked. Çayırhan
Village
Çayırhan is a neighbourhood in the municipality and district of Nallıhan, Ankara Province, Turkey. Its population is 8,156. Before the 2013 reorganisation, it was a town. Çayırhan is situated 3½ km north of Aladağ Çayı.
